Forklift attachments also require maintenance, like for example roll and barrel clamps, rotators, sideshifters, man baskets and drum handlers. Telescopic handlers are somewhat like forklifts. It has a single telescopic boom that extends both forwards and upwards from the truck, and a counterweight located in the rear. It functions a lot more like a crane than a forklift. The boom could be outfitted with different types of attachments. The most popular attachment is pallet forks, but the operator can also attach a bucket, muck grab or lift table. Also known as a telehandler, this type of machine is normally used in industry and agriculture. When it is difficult for a conventional forklift to access areas, a telehandler is frequently utilized to transport loads. Telehandlers are usually utilized to unload pallets from within a trailer. They are also more practical than a crane for lifting loads onto other high locations and rooftops. There is only one major limitation in using telehandlers. Even with rear counterweights, the weight-bearing boom could cause the vehicle to destabilize as it extends. Therefore, the lifting capacity lessens as the distance between the center of the load and the front of the wheels increases. The Matbro company developed telehandlers in England. Their design was based mainly on articulated cross country forklifts utilized in forestry. First models had a centrally mounted boom on the front and a driver's cab on the rear section, but today the most popular design has a strong chassis along with a side cab and rear mounted boom. Yale: Used Yale IC Forklifts Fontana - Internal Combustion Lift Trucks The IC forklift belongs within the class V and IV forklift classification. They could be liquid propane, gas or diesel models. Mostly, the ICE or internal combustion engine models are used outdoors, since they could function in severe weather and emit some emissions. However, propane-powered models, can be utilized indoors provided that proper ventilation is used. It is best to know what types of settings you will be working in and what particular requirements you need to use the forklift for, to be able to make sure that you pick the best model to meet all of your requirements. ICE Benefits Some of the benefits of internal combustion engines consist of a lower initial purchase price, compared to a similar capacity electric truck. This can range anywhere from 20% to 40% lower. The ICE units are easy and fast to refuel. This feature really reduces downtime as there is no requirement to recharge any batteries, like there is with electric models. Most often, Internal Combustion Engine units offer higher performance capabilities compared to the similarly equipped electric truck. The heavier capacity is usually available in these units compared to electric trucks. Over recent years, there have been numerous changes regarding emissions technology and this has resulted in lesser total emission levels. Internal combustion engine trucks remain popular with load sizes roughly 8,000 pounds and even much higher in certain operations like for example ports, lumberyard settings and steel manufacturing facilities. ICE Drawbacks The Internal Combustion units do suffer from several disadvantages including a higher cost-per-hour to operate as compared to electric trucks, due to the excess needs for fuel. In addition, these units usually produce more noise compared to the electric models because they run louder. ICE trucks also have fuel-storage requirements to consider too.

CAT: Used CAT Loaded Container Handlers Fontana - The intermodal container could be called by other names such as a box, ISO Container, high-cube container, freight container, sea box, conex box, and container. These models are manufactured from standardized reusable steel. They provide safe and secure and effective storage for transporting materials all around the globe via a global containerized intermodal freight system. The word "Intermodal" refers that the container can be moved from one type of transport to another. For example, intermodal refers from ship to truck or ship to rail, without having to reload and unload the container's contents. Several of the container lengths which have a unique ISO 6346 reporting mark on them vary from 8-feet or 2.438 m to 56 feet or 17.07m. These models are as high as 2.438 m or 8feet to 9 feet, 6 inches or 2.9 m. It is estimated that there are around 17 million intermodal containers in the world of various types to suit a variety of cargoes. These containers can be transported by semi-truck trailer, container ship and freight trains. They can also travel many distances without having to be unpacked. At container terminals, they are transferred between modes by container cranes. A reach-stacker is normally utilized to transfer from a flat-bed truck to a rail car. These models are secured during transportation by a range of "twistlock" points located at every corner on the container. Each and every container is outfitted with a certain BIC code or bin identification code that is painted on the outside in order to take care of identification and tracking. These units are capable of carrying items ranging approximately 20 to 25 tonnes. For transport on rails, the container could be carried on flatcars or on well cars. Well cars have been designed particularly for use by intermodal containers. They could accommodate double-stacked containers safely and efficiently. The loading gauge of a rail system can actually limit the types of container shipment and the particular modes of the shipment. Like for example, the smaller loading gauges which are typically found in European railroads will just handle single-stacked containers. In some nations like for instance the United Kingdom, there are certain sections of the rail network that cannot accommodate high-cube containers, unless they could use well cars only. These containers are made to last and are utilized to travel extreme distances. They are re-used with businesses and can lift an enormous amount of cargo. These containers are responsible for transporting numerous of the objects we rely on everyday around the globe.

Jungheinrich: Used Jungheinrich Warehouse Forklift Fontana - Environmental Issues About Electric Lift Truck Batteries Electric forklifts are usually safer and more stable than gas and diesel powered lift trucks. Diesel and gasoline engines emit toxic exhaust and pose a risk of fire. However, electric lift trucks could be dangerous, as well. They have rechargeable batteries as their power source, and batteries could present risks to the environment as well as to personal safety. There are risks connected with the use, manufacture, disposal and storage of rechargeable batteries for forklifts. Manufacturing Nearly all forklift batteries are made by placing lead plates into a solution of sulfuric acid. These are referred to as lead-acid rechargeable batteries. Lead is a toxin that, when utilized in manufacturing processes, poses hazards to the quality of water due to drainage and runoff. Once lead enters a water system it can lead to different types of health problems to people and can even be fatal. The sulfuric acid used in forklift batteries is harmful to skin and can cause severe burns. Sulfuric acid also produces noxious fumes that can cause damage to both human beings and the natural environment. Normal Storage and Use Lead-acid batteries can produce hydrogen gas as a chemical byproduct when recharging. When recharging batteries for a lift truck or any other kinds of vehicle, flames, heat, smoking and sparks must be kept well away from the recharging site. The combustible hydrogen could result in an explosion if ignited by flame or heat. If it touches the bare skin, sulfuric acid in the batteries could result in chemical burns. This is not a concern during normal use of the battery, but if a battery is damaged or punctured, the acid could leak or spray, potentially burning anyone who is nearby. Disposal Disposing of lead-acid batteries improperly must be avoided at all costs. The sulfuric acid could either be recycled or neutralized or can be reused in new batteries. To be able to avoid the serious environmental consequences of incorrect disposal, all lead-acid batteries sold or purchased in the U.S. include a "core charge" which will only be returned if the used battery is turned in.

Nissan: Used Nissan LP Forklifts Fontana - Propane Forklifts One inconvenience of propane tanks is to have to change, though there are some risks to running out of fuel on a propane forklift. These models tend to be less expensive to run compared to the electric and diesel unit forklift. The discussion to whether or not the propane emissions are cleaner compared to diesel emissions continues within the industry. Performance wise, propane lift trucks seem to handle better compared to most electric models available on the market when the task needs constant duty drive line torque and high applications. There are some electric units that are reputed to handle equally or better. Depending on the particular situation, propane lifts may or may not be acceptable for handling food and edible goods. So long as WorkSafeBC criteria are met, propane lift trucks are suitable for the majority of indoor applications. The Disadvantages of LPG Propane Forklifts The LPG's major drawbacks when compare to the diesel lift truck includes the fact that they are not as effective when performing tasks that require high and or constant duty drive line torque. These units have a liability exposure, due to the possibility of a fuel system leak while the truck is located indoors. Furthermore, operators must be trained on the safe use of propane fuel. The rearward visibility off of the back end of the counterweight is limited. This is because of the location of the propane tank. Compared to electric and diesel units, fuel cost is higher with propane models. There are possible injury claims because of the weight and frequency that propane tanks are changed; roughly every 6 hours of usage unless the place has a bulk fill station located there. Propane lift trucks can be more difficult to start and run smoothly when they are utilized in cold temperatures. In remote locations, propane fuel is not always readily available. In the next few decades, the fossil fuel cost is estimated to rise dramatically. Consider and plan for overall expense or repair and maintenance, as well as the total cost of ownership to be the highest of the 3 options. Komatsu: Used Komatsu Diesel Forklift Fontana - Lift trucks are used to raise, engage and transfer palletized loads within manufacturing, warehousing, material handling, mining and construction applications. There are 3 main types of forklifts: a manual drive, motorized drive and fork truck. The travel or load movement is powered manually or by walking behind the machine with manual-drive lift trucks. Motorized-drive model lift trucks are equipped with a motorized drive. In many instances, a seat or protected cab is part of the design in order to keep the operator comfortable and safe. Fork trucks are a different type that are motorized and consist of features like backup alarms and cabs. In order to prevent the machinery from turning over, some forklifts are counterbalanced. Other models comprise safety rails, a rotating element like a turntable or different kinds of hand rails. Important specifications to take into account when selecting forklifts comprise lift capacity and stroke. Stroke is defined as the difference between the fully-lowered and the fully-raised lift positions. Lift capacity is the maximum, supportable load or forcforce or load. Additional specifications for lift trucks comprise their tire and type of fuel. Different fuel options for lift trucks consist of: LP or liquid propane, compressed natural gas or CNG, propane, diesel fuel, natural gas and gasoline. There are 2 basic types of tires for operating forklifts and fork trucks: pneumatic and solid. Cushion or solid tires require less maintenance compared to pneumatic tires and do not puncture. The solid or cushion tires do offer less shock absorption in general. Pneumatic or air-inflated tires however provide excellent drive traction and load-cushioning. For forklifts, there are 7 classes. Class 1 lift trucks incorporate electric-motor rider trucks, seated or stand-up 3 wheeled units. Normally, rider units are counterbalanced and can have either pneumatic or cushion wheels. Class II forklifts are electric motor units which are used for order picking or stock applications in narrow aisle setting. These models provide extra swing mast or reach functions. Class III forklifts are either standing-rider or walk-behind operated electric-motor trucks. Automated pallet lift trucks and high lift models are normally counterbalanced units. Class IV forklifts have seated controls and cabs. These models are rider fork trucks with IC or internal combustion engines. In addition, this class uses cushion or solid tires. Rider fork Trucks are included in Class V. These machines will have cabs and seated controls, pneumatic tires and IC or internal combustion engines. Similar to Class IV lift trucks, they are usually counterbalanced. Class VI forklifts are tow tractor lifts which are designed for a sit-down rider. This class is supplied with internal combustion or IC or electric engines. Lastly, Class VII forklifts are the perfect option for use on rough terrain areas. They are a common feature in construction, logging and agricultural applications. Class VII lift trucks consist of all employee carriers and burden carriers.

Comedil: Used Comedil Cranes Fontana - Tower Cranes Grow to New Heights In the 1950s in the tower crane business, there were numerous important developments in the design of these large cranes. Numerous manufacturers were started producing bottom slewing cranes with a telescoping mast. These types of machines dominated the construction business for both office and apartment block construction. Many of the top tower crane manufacturers abandoned the use of cantilever jib designs. In its place, they made the switch to luffing jibs and in time, utilizing luffing jibs became the regular practice. Within Europe, there were key improvements being made in the design and development of tower cranes. Usually, construction locations were constricted areas. Relying upon rail systems to transport a large number of tower cranes, ended up being very expensive and inconvenient. Some manufacturers were providing saddle jib cranes which had hook heights of 80 meters or 262 feet. These cranes were equipped with self-climbing mechanisms that allowed parts of mast to be inserted into the crane so that it could grow along with the structures it was constructing upwards. The long jibs on these specific cranes also covered a larger work area. All of these developments precipitated the practice of erecting and anchoring cranes in a building's lift shaft. After that, this is the technique that became the industry standard. From the 1960s, the main focus on tower crane development and design started to cover a higher load moment, covering a larger job radius, climbing mechanisms and technology, faster erection strategies, and new control systems. Furthermore, focus was spent on faster erection strategies with the most significant developments being made in the drive technology department, amongst other things.

Toyota: Used Toyota Narrow Reach Forklifts Fontana - A sit-down counterbalanced lift truck is a standard forklift vehicle which is commonly visualized when most people imagine a forklift or lift truck. This machinery come in any of the tire types such as pneumatic or solid options as well as different fuel types like for example diesel, gas, and electric models. It has various kinds of attachments, weight capacities and lift heights. The workhorses within most warehouses are the smaller 3000 lb. to 4000 lb. trucks. If you are running a smaller operation and are only able to have one truck, this is an ideal choice as it is a very practical option. The regular forklift is a wide aisle truck which requires at least 11' aisles to turn in. The aisle's width is determined by the turn radius, the size of the truck as well as the load size. Available options and attachments include hydraulic clamps, slip sheet attachments, fork shifts and side shifts. Reach Truck Reach trucks or double-deep reach, stand-up reach, and straddle reach trucks are a specially designed narrow aisle reach truck utilized for racked pallet storage. This unit measures 8' to 10'. The reach truck has telescoping forks and utilizes outriggers in front as well as a hydraulic scissors-type device. The hydraulic scissors kind of mechanism allows you to pick up the load and retract it over the outriggers. This design allows the operator to turn in a narrower aisle by reducing the truck's overall load length. The double-deep reach trucks allow the operator to store pallets 2 deep in a uniquely designed double-deep rack. This outcome is provided by a specially extended reach device. Reach trucks are made only for racking areas. They do not work well for loading trucks or for quickly transporting loads over distances. These reach trucks make particular easy work of some specific heavy-duty applications.

TCM: Used TCM Used Forklifts Fontana - Forklifts are categorized into the following kinds based on the structure: Standard Trucks: Standard Trucks make up the strong and big models which are normally utilized in factories. Standard trucks could normally lift weights between 3,000 pounds to 4,000 pounds and their blades can lift cargo up to a height of 20 feet. Reach Truck: Reach Trucks are a different name for narrow-aisle forklifts. Usually, these equipment run on electricity. These equipment are particularly designed for pallet storage. They are capable of carrying cargo up to 40 feet in height. If you want unloading and raising weights quickly and over long distances, than a reach truck would not be the right option for your application. Order Selector: Order Selectors are very narrow aisle trucks which are utilized to transport racked loads that are smaller than pallet size. Order Selectors are different in that they could lift both the cargo and the truck operator as high as 40 feet. Motorized Pallet Trucks: Motorized Pallet Trucks are also referred to as walkies, walkie riders and riders. These models are appropriately named due to the fact that the driver is not required to sit in the machine in order to operate it. Instead, the driver walks beside the truck as it moves the cargo. Swing Mast Trucks: Swing Mast Trucks are similar in appearance to typical units of trucks. These are vehicles with a narrow aisle and have masts that can swing up to 90 degrees, only in one direction. Turret Trucks: Turret Trucks are also designed with a very narrow aisle. Similar to an Order Selector, they can lift the driver and the cargo. Furthermore, these types of trucks can swing their forks 90 degree on each side. Kalmar: Used Kalmar Loaded Container Handlers Fontana - Container Handling Tips A "loaded container" by description is a container other than in the tare or empty condition, in reference to container handling. Unless otherwise confirmed, containers should be treated as loaded. In order to maintain safety, when securing or handling containers, environmental conditions such as wind must be taken into consideration. The term loaded refers to the maximum gross weigh rating of the container. To be able to ensure that the centre of gravity is kept as central and low as possible, the cargo should be distributed all around the container. Having an equally distributed load it is helpful to avoid excessive tilting, and lack of vehicle stability, in order to maintain safety. An even load helps to avoid unacceptable load concentrations, and unacceptable vehicle axle loading. The eccentricity of the center of gravity differs, with the distribution of load in the container. It is very important that the designers of handling equipment and containers take this into consideration in the engineering process. Like for instance, when 60 percent of the load by mass is distributed in 50% of the container length measured from one end of the machine, the eccentricity corresponds to 5%. In order to make certain that the machinery used is perfect for the cargo, care needs to be taken to make certain it is safely attached to the container and that the container is free to be handled. Particular attention should be paid to the possibility of the container tilting due to the eccentricity of the center of gravity. When raising any container whose centre of gravity is mobile or eccentric, like for instance a bulk container, a tank container a thermal container with a refrigerating unit or a container with a liquid bulk bag, either clip on or integral, or any container with a hanging load, great care must be taken when lifting these. Carelift: Used Carelift Telehandlers Fontana - The boom lift would have a telescopic extension or an articulating arm for the purpose of lifting individuals or supplies. These machines are normally used in utility applications as well as in the construction industry. The boom lifts fall under the "aerial equipment" category. Telescopic booms are known to have a straight arm which increases in height and extends in length. As well, articulating booms are made to be raised, but offer a multi-piece arm for the ability of reaching an elevated location or work platform. Both telescopic booms and articulating booms could be self-contained with their own drive trains, or could be mounted on trailers or vehicles. Some models utilize wheels, whilst other designs have stabilizing tracks or legs. Telehandlers are telescopic booms that incorporate a full vehicle into their design structure. These boom lifts are simple to maneuver all around a construction location due to their design being equipped with wheels and drive trains. Analyzing specific features and product specifications is vital in choosing the proper boom to suit your specific needs. For example, the width horizontal reach, working height and the lift or load capacity are standard measurements to think about. The power system options and the various platform designs are other essential features to consider. Boom lift platforms are normally made from steel, and will often have a swing gate for walk-in access or a sliding, mid-rail gate. Several boom lift styles provide tri-entry features that offer sliding mid-rail entrances on the front of the platform and both ends of the platform. Platform accessories include travel alarms, welder leads, air lines and additional railings. Tool trays and work lights are also available. When it comes to power options, some models are available with 3-phase AC generator to enable welding operations. The generator may be belt-driven or hydraulic-driven, depending on the unit. In terms of potential features, engine options and tire types, boom lift units differ greatly. The tires on a boom lift can be filled with foam or air, for example and they can be categorized as non-marking. There are available models which are outfitted with rubber tires as well. The engine on a boom lift may use diesel fuel or gasoline. These machinery can be outfitted with a cold-weather package. This package normally comes with accessories like: a battery blanket and synthetic motor oil. There are numerous available extra features and styles for boom lifts in order to guarantee they are suitable for specific settings.

Wolff: Used Wolff Construction Cranes Fontana - Hydraulic truck cranes are different from other crane types due to the way they specifically work. Hydraulic cranes use oil rather than utilizing a winch in order to wind up cables to provide the lifting force. Since oil is a fluid that retains its volume, it is incompressible. Hence, this means it is one of the most ideal kinds of fluids for pushing pistons towards the direction the force is going to be exerted. The hydraulic pump generates a pressure that moves the piston. This action is maneuvered by the driver from the controls in his cab. Normally, hydraulic truck cranes use a pump that has 2 gears. The truck mounted crane could move from one location to another with little need for dismantling. The truck crane has a single engine which can control both the crane and the truck. Other Parts Boom Telescope: The boom telescope is due to a specific hydraulic operation which enables the boom to retract or extend. Jib: Jibs are latticed structure booms.. Boom Swing: The boom swing is a big roller or ball that is connected to the carrier. It is able to swing 360 degrees in both directions. Hydraulic devices provide swings at varying speeds and control the swing in order to rotate the turntable gearbox. Outrigger: The outrigger is a unit which helps the crane maintain its balance by using hydraulics to lift the truck. Load Movement Indicator: In order to warn the driver that maximum weight is approaching, the load movement indicator's lights flash. Pump: The pump's purpose is to steer the outrigger. Steel Cables: Steel reinforced cables run through the boom and the jib. They can generate up to 6350 kg or 14,000 lbs. Boom Elevation: The boom of the crane ascends with the use of double hydraulic cylinders which can be raised and lowered. Rotex Gear: The rotex gear is operated by hydraulics and situated under the cab. It enables the boom to swivel on this gear.

Terex: Used Terex Scissor Lifts Fontana - Scissor Lifts Scissor lifts have been designed to offer a larger work area and are usually utilized to raise multiple employees requiring access to the same platform. This particular kind of aerial lift is utilized for raising individuals, supplies and heavy machinery. These industrial machines come in many colors, sizes and varieties. Nearly all scissor lifts and hydraulic lifts run by either electricity or gas. Because of their quiet nature, electric models are usually utilized for inside applications such as warehouse settings because they are a lot less noisy. Scissor lifts that are powered by either gas or diesel are usually known as rough-terrain lifts which are more suited for jobsites outdoors. Scissor lifts are very common equipment in the industrialized world, and are vital material handling equipment. There are a variety of different model types offered on the market. For example, a few are designed to handle a load of up to 50 tons, whilst others more resemble portable carts that are small and only able to lift loads which weigh up to a couple of hundred pounds.
